Cast Iron Skillets are a great cooking tool. My family uses them mostly for Swedish pancakes. The only problem is that the handle can get really hot! They sell covers in the store but, I have never wanted to spend the money. This is what I came up with, it is cute and it works great.
Items needed:
5"x5" scrap piece of cotton fabric
5"x5" scrap piece of warm and natural cotton batting or warm and natural insul-bright insulation
Pins
Piece of paper
marker
Step#1
Trace the handle of a cast iron pan. Add 1" to the pattern.

Step #2
Cut out 2 pieces of fabric and 2 pieces of batting

Step # 3
Pin the fabric to the batting right sides together

Step #4
Sew 1/4" across the bottom of handle.( I used my serger, but a sewing machine works as well) Turn the fabric to right side and Iron

Step #5
pin both handles right sides together. Sew 1/4" together leaving bottom of the handle open.

Step #6
Turn to the right side out. Iron. Put on skillet handle and enjoy!
